Decoding the Digital World: A Look Inside Computers

The complex world of computers can seem like magic to the untrained eye. Beneath the smooth surfaces, however, lies a realm of algorithms and electricity. At its core, a computer is a device that manipulates information according to a set of defined commands.

This processing involves an intricate symphony between various components, each playing a essential role. The central processing unit (CPU), often referred to as the computer's "brain," interprets these instructions, while RAM provides the workspace for data and programs.

Input devices, such as keyboards and mice, allow us to communicate information into the system. Conversely, Displays present the results of this computation in a interpretable format.

The Evolution of Computing From Abacus to AI

From the rudimentary operations performed on an abacus thousands of years ago to the sophisticated algorithms driving artificial intelligence today, the evolution of computing has been a astounding journey. Early tools like the Pascal's engine laid the groundwork for more sophisticated systems. The invention of the microprocessor revolutionized computing, paving the way for portable computers and ultimately, the ubiquitous technology we depend upon today.

  • Furthermore, the development of digital frameworks has been crucial to making computers intuitive.
  • Today, the field of artificial intelligence delves into the design of intelligent agents capable of performing tasks that traditionally require human understanding.

Computing power|continues to develop, we can expect even more transformative changes in the world of computing.

Unlocking the Power of Processors: Understanding CPU Architecture

Delving into the heart of a computer system, CPU architecture provides essential insights into how processors function. A CPU's design encompasses multiple components, each playing a indispensable role in executing instructions and propelling computations. From the processing unit to the register system, understanding these building blocks is essential for comprehending a CPU's potential. By exploring the intricate organization of CPUs, we can gain valuable knowledge about their efficiency and how they impact the overall performance of computer systems.

  • Architecture is a complex system.
  • CPUs can be categorized based on their features.

Immerse yourself in Data's Playground: Exploring the Realm of Computer Memory

In the dynamic world of/within/throughout computing, data reigns supreme. get more info Its lifeline/heartbeat/essence is stored and manipulated within a realm known as computer memory. This vast/expansive/limitless landscape holds/contains/shelters our digital artifacts/treasures/assets, from simple text files to complex algorithms.

Memory functions/operates/acts in harmonious/synchronized/seamless ways, orchestrating/guiding/controlling the flow of information that powers our devices/machines/gadgets. It's a complex/intricate/multifaceted system composed/structured/built of various types of memory, each with its own uniqueness/distinctive traits/specific purpose.

  • Exploring/Delving into/Unveiling the different types of memory - RAM, ROM, cache, and more - reveals the intricacies/nuances/complexities of this crucial component/part/element
  • Understanding/Grasping/Comprehending how memory interacts/communicates/coexists with the CPU is key to unlocking/deciphering/unraveling the mysteries/secrets/inner workings of computer performance.

Let's/Allow us to/Venture together embark on a journey into data's playground and discover/explore/uncover the fascinating realm of computer memory.

Binary Code and Beyond: The Language of Computers

Computers operate on a fundamental level using binary code/digital instructions/machine language. This system represents information as sequences of zeros/ones/bits, each representing/signifying/encoding a specific value. While seemingly simple, this foundation/backbone/core allows for the execution of complex tasks, from calculations/data processing/algorithmic operations to graphical displays/audio output/interactive experiences. However, human interaction with computers typically involves higher-level languages/programming languages/software frameworks, which provide a more intuitive/accessible/user-friendly interface.

  • Programmers/Software Developers/Code Wizards
  • Translate/Convert/Map

These languages, such as Python/Java/C++, offer a variety of structures/features/tools that make it easier to design/build/create software applications. As technology continues to evolve, new and more sophisticated languages/paradigms/approaches emerge, pushing the boundaries of what's possible in the world of computer science.

Linking the Dots: Networks and the Internet Age

The modern age has fundamentally reshaped our lives through the unprecedented connectivity of networks. The internet, a vast spider's web of information and communication, facilitates individuals to exchange knowledge and ideas at an astonishing rate. Online networks have become integral spaces for engagement, fostering new communities and influencing social trends. This intricate network landscape presents both challenges and demands a deeper understanding of its mechanisms.

  • Furthermore

Leave a Reply

Your email address will not be published. Required fields are marked *